#8e5ef0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8e5ef0 is composed of 55.7% red, 36.9% green and 94.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 40.8% cyan, 60.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 259.7 degrees, a saturation of 83% and a lightness of 65.5%. #8e5ef0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ffbcff with #1d00e1. Closest websafe color is: #9966ff.

Shades and Tints of #8e5ef0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f3eef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#8e5ef0

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a5a2ac is the less saturated color, while #8950fe is the most saturated one.
